The Community Shopping Center

Community shopping centers are vital spots for residents, providing a convenient location to acquire everyday products. These open-air developments often feature a varied range of businesses, from food stores and drugstores to apparel boutiques.

With their convenient design, community shopping centers encourage a sense of belonging by connecting people together. They also add to the commercial health of nearby communities by providing employment and supporting local businesses.
